Qualification Description
This qualification reflects the role of individuals working as developing and emerging leaders and managers in a range of enterprise and industry contexts. As well as assuming responsibility for their own performance, individuals at this level are likely to provide leadership, guidance and support to others. They may also have some responsibility for organising and monitoring the output of teams.
They apply solutions to a defined range of predictable and unpredictable problems, and analyse and evaluate information from a variety of sources.

Units of Competence
The qualification covers twelve (12) units of competence, five (5) core units and seven (7) elective units. Of these seven, four (4) electives come from Group A, and the remaining three (3) should be chosen from Group B.
CORE UNITS (Five (5) compulsory units)
BSBLDR411 Demonstrate leadership in the workplace
BSBLDR413 Lead effective workplace relationships
BSBOPS402 Coordinate business operational plans
BSBXCM401 Apply communication strategies in the workplace
BSBXTW401 Lead and facilitate a team
ELECTIVE UNITS
Group A (Four (4) elective units from below)
BSBCRT411 Apply critical thinking to work practices
BSBCRT413 Collaborate in creative processes
BSBTWK401 Build and maintain business relationships
BSBWHS411 Implement and monitor WHS policies, procedures and programs
Group B (Choose three (3) elective units from below)
BSBCRT412 Articulate, present and debate ideas
BSBPEF502 Develop and use emotional intelligence
BSBPMG430 Undertake project work
BSBWRT411 Write complex documents

Entry Requirements
There are no formal pre-requisites for studying this qualification, but candidates should have the literacy and numeracy skills required to study at a certificate IV level. In order to successfully complete the qualification we recommend that candidates should have one of the following:
-
hold a Certificate III
-
have relevant vocational practice, without formal qualifications
-
have other educational qualifications and some vocational experience.
